Output 27fb56a4c7297c78cd85fbf922c2913a3917a983f3dadceaa18aa087b7231f25:5

value
657521986
script pubkey
OP_0 OP_PUSHBYTES_32 01ecdeb827661566c197bba62bd883fc052adba332462655efbe473f637ad3bb
address
bc1qq8kdawp8vc2kdsvhhwnzhkyrlszj4karxfrzv400hern7cm66wasgx3kk4
transaction
27fb56a4c7297c78cd85fbf922c2913a3917a983f3dadceaa18aa087b7231f25
spent
true